UHF Antennas Direct 91XG (aka XG91) 23-Director Corner-FD-Yagi analyzed using 4nec2. [Folded Dipole, 1-ea Director-Rod, 22-ea Bowtie Directors (ALL SAME SIZE) & a Corner Reflector.] Boom Length=90.2-in.
RevA: UHF Raw Gain = 11.5 dbi (470 MHz) to 16.9 dBi (698 MHz) to 17.8 dbi (758 MHz), F/R & F/B Ratio Min = 19.9 dB (Excellent) and SWR (300-ohms) Under 3.0 (Fair).
RevF: UHF Raw Gain = 11.3 dbi (470 MHz) to 16.6 dBi (698 MHz) to 17.5 dbi (758 MHz), F/R & F/B Ratio Min = 19.8 dB (Excellent) and SWR (300-ohms) Under 2.3 (Excellent).
Hi-VHF Raw Gain plots show a reasonable amount of Gain, with more toward the REAR. SWR is very excessive, which may or may not cause problems, esp. on weak channels. However, a couple years ago A-D changed to a PCB Balun (vice usual Hybrid Transformer) which has very high loss on VHF frequencies....so Hi-VHF charts only apply to old versions.
XG91a.nec file was converted (by 300ohm) from Ken Nist's EZNEC file: http://www.wuala.com/300ohm/Documents 300ohm also posted a 4nec2 file for a 91XG with SIX additional Directors. Boom Length=122.1-in.
I added some FR and RP statements and a variable SOURCE wire radius to adjust AGT=1.0 for both UHF and Hi-VHF (XG91a_RevA.nec). The latest, XG91a_RevF.nec, removed some extraneous wires from the Directors, eliminating "Sharp Angle" Warnings and changed SOURCE Wire so AGT=1.0 and NO Errors or Warnings.
NOTE: There are several variations of the XG91/91XG from different manufacturers. Carefully check your dimensions against Ken Nist's model...esp. if you think you have a 75-ohm balun.
